Continue ReadingThese five linebackers have improved greatly over this past season. Not only did they turn heads for the rankings, but also in their recruiting. Most of the linebackers listed have now signed with their future colleges. These are the five linebackers who have stuck out after the 2021 season.
1. Kip Lewis Kip Lewis 6'2" | 200 lbs | LB Carthage | 2022 State TX – Carthage High School (Carthage, TX)
Lewis recently signed with Oklahoma on Dec. 15. He amassed a total of 22 offers thus far and has made huge strides across the country. He has all the skills of an elite linebacker. The speed, power, and awareness are all on display in his tape. He is constantly watching where the ball is going and is planning two steps ahead. Lewis is able to break off most blocks to make the play. Overall, he is a power-five linebacker in the making.
2. Treylin Payne Treylin Payne 6'0" | 200 lbs | LB Judson | 2022 State TX – Judson High School (Converse, TX)
Much like Lewis, Payne also exhibits an excellent skillset. However, what Payne also adds is excellent pass coverage, especially in zone. He is an interception machine which is not always common amongst linebackers. He has incredible strength and can stop just about any running back in his tracks. He also has had a hand in special teams plays and has proven to be reliable on onside kicks. Payne cements himself as a well-rounded player. He, too, signed on Dec. 15 but with Houston.
3. Owen Pewee Owen Pewee 6'3" | 190 lbs | LB Cypress Park | 2022 State TX – Cypress Park High School (Cypress, TX)
Pewee decided to stay in his home state much like Payne, and signed with UTSA on Dec. 15. Pewee has speed on his side as he also plays on the receiver position from time to time. His agility and athleticism are incredible. Much like Payne, he is also fantastic in pass coverage and is a natural ball hawk. If he is able to snag an interception, he is dangerous on the return with his speed.
4. Barrett Baker Barrett Baker 6'4" | 205 lbs | LB Southlake Carroll | 2022 State TX – Southlake Carroll (Southlake, TX)
Baker also has excellent awareness and decision-making skills. If the situation presents itself, he fully takes the opportunity and rarely misses it. He has fantastic focus and his eyes are always on the ball. On top of that, he is completely disruptive in the backfield and has caused several offenses issues. According to 247Sports, he has no offers yet, but that should change based on his tape alone.
5. Ty Kana Ty Kana 6'2" | 210 lbs | LB Katy | 2022 State TX – Katy High School (Katy, TX)
Kana signed with Texas Tech on Dec. 15. The Katy area is known for producing some excellent football players, and Kana is no exception. He received a total of 13 offers including USC, Baylor, Colorado, and Georgia Tech. What makes Kana special is his pure strength. He is able to push offensive linemen back into the backfield and is able to maintain his focus with linemen in his face. He has excellent play recognition and much like Baker is an opportunist. Kana should fit right in with the other Texas Tech signees.
